How much do software engineer three j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 24, 2026, the average yearly pay for software engineer three in Wilson, NC is $128,938.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$104,900.00 and $151,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Software Engineer Three vs Software Engineer Two?

AspectSoftware Engineer ThreeSoftware Engineer Two
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in CS or related field; 3+ years experienceBachelor's degree in CS or related field; 1-3 years experience
Work EnvironmentCollaborates on complex projects, mentors junior staffWorks on assigned modules, less mentorship responsibility
Employer & Industry UsageCommonly used in tech companies, software firmsWidely used across similar industries
Search & Comparison IntentOften compared for career progression, salary benchmarksOften compared to understand role differences

Software Engineer Three typically has more experience, handles complex tasks, and mentors others compared to Software Engineer Two. The roles are part of a progression path in software development, with Software Engineer Three expected to take on greater responsibilities and demonstrate advanced technical skills.

Job Description:
The Quality Engineer III - Instrument Validation will be responsible for:
Serving as validation representative for instruments
Partnering with the laboratories, quality system administrators, BT, instrumentation and quality on implementing new instruments at the site
Performing analytical instrument validation including computerized system validation if applicable
Performing any validation change control during the life-cycle of the system
Performing system periodic review
Performing system decommissioning
This position will be responsible for providing end-user support for all Quality Laboratory groups as well as compliance to global and site internal policies and procedures.
ROLE RESPONSIBILITIES
Initiates and leads change control for implementation of new instruments or changes to existing analytical instrumentation and associated instrument control software where applicable in Quality Control laboratories.
Authors cGMP risk assessments, user requirements & functional specifications, validation plans, protocols (i.e. IQ, OQ, PQ), reports, addendums and other validation deliverables as required by the site validation SOPs.
Assist the system owner with evaluating recommending the appropriate user roles and privileges for data integrity (where applicable), writing instrument operation instructions and preventive maintenance plans.
Ensures lab instrument's adherence to national and international regulatory guidelines on Electronic Records and Electronic Signatures and Data Integrity, cGMP, FDA 21 CFR Part 11/210/211, EU Annex 11, MHRA guidelines. Authors protocol to challenge the main aspects of these requirements during validation to demonstrate adherence. For systems found unable to fully comply, formulate workarounds/strategies with core stake holders to mitigate the gaps.
Initiates and leads risk assessment, gap analysis, and deviation management associated with validation of lab instruments.
Completes periodic reviews of instruments and instrument control software with focus on change control, deviation investigations, and CAPA to ensure compliance and validated state of the instrument. Previous experience with PR/CAPA systems preferred.
Reviews validation deliverables created by others for adherence to site validation SOPs and acts as validation approver as needed.
